<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
</head>
<body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; font-size: 14px; font-family: Calibri, sans-serif;">
<div style="color: rgb(0, 0, 0);">Thanks for the explanation...!</div>
<div style="color: rgb(0, 0, 0);"><br>
</div>
<span id="OLK_SRC_BODY_SECTION">
<blockquote id="MAC_OUTLOOK_ATTRIBUTION_BLOCKQUOTE" style="border-left-color: rgb(181, 196, 223); border-left-width: 5px; border-left-style: solid; padding: 0px 0px 0px 5px; margin: 0px 0px 0px 5px;">
<div>
<div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">
<div style="color: rgb(0, 0, 0);">
<div><br class="">
</div>
Let me try a simple explanation: </div>
<div style="color: rgb(0, 0, 0);">1/ a LINK is to get an interest to the place where the name in the interest can be used directly for lookup</div>
<div>2/ routers do FIB lookup using LINK first (if interest carries one), until the interest reaches the place (so called "region") where
<font color="#ff0000">its</font> name is in the FIB, then the router will do look up using the interest name</div>
</div>
</div>
</blockquote>
</span>
<div style="color: rgb(0, 0, 0);"><br>
</div>
<div style="color: rgb(0, 0, 0);">(Just to double-check - what's the "its" here?) </div>
<div style="color: rgb(0, 0, 0);"><br>
</div>
<span id="OLK_SRC_BODY_SECTION" style="color: rgb(0, 0, 0);">
<blockquote id="MAC_OUTLOOK_ATTRIBUTION_BLOCKQUOTE" style="BORDER-LEFT: #b5c4df 5 solid; PADDING:0 0 0 5; MARGIN:0 0 0 5;">
<div>
<div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">
<div>3/ a router decides whether the LINK has finished its job by comparing LINK with its own name: if the LINK is either its prefix or an exact match to the name, then the LINK is no longer needed.</div>
</div>
</div>
</blockquote>
</span>
<div style="color: rgb(0, 0, 0);"><br>
</div>
<div style="color: rgb(0, 0, 0);">Not sure I follow – why should the router care whether the LINK name has anything to do with
<i>its </i>name, shouldn't it only care if it can forward based on the Interest name or not?  (And, I guess, if it is "responsible" the LINK prefix?) </div>
<div style="color: rgb(0, 0, 0);"><br>
</div>
<div style="color: rgb(0, 0, 0);">
<div>I think I understand the basic idea but am confused about the introduction of the router's administrative identity into forwarding decisions.  Isn't the point simply that the Interest reaches a router that is 1) sufficiently "responsible" for the LINK
 prefix that it can ignore it and 2) capable of forwarding the Interest name itself?   I guess this is the point of the regions list – to define responsibility? </div>
<div><br>
</div>
<div>(Also, if I am correct, the word 'region' seems to unnecessarily imply a perimeter / geographic boundary rather than a capability.  I wonder if it is the right term.)</div>
<div><br>
</div>
<div>To use a specific example:</div>
<div><br>
</div>
<div>When an Interest with LINK /com/microsoft/healthvault reaches a router /com/microsoft/routers/us/west/foo/47 at the edge of its AS, that router could have a region entry for "/com/microsoft/healthvault" and directly forward "/org/openmhealth" appropriately.
  This doesn't meet the link prefix matching requirement but isn't unreasonable...?  Or am I missing something?</div>
<div><br>
</div>
</div>
<span id="OLK_SRC_BODY_SECTION" style="color: rgb(0, 0, 0);">
<blockquote id="MAC_OUTLOOK_ATTRIBUTION_BLOCKQUOTE" style="BORDER-LEFT: #b5c4df 5 solid; PADDING:0 0 0 5; MARGIN:0 0 0 5;">
<div>
<div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">
<div><br class="">
</div>
<div>Every entity in an NDN network should know its own name (how it learns the name is design/implementation question).</div>
</div>
</div>
</blockquote>
</span>
<div style="color: rgb(0, 0, 0);"><br>
</div>
<div style="color: rgb(0, 0, 0);">Yes, but does entity name correspond directly to forwarding responsibility?  (Is this convention or requirement?)</div>
<div style="color: rgb(0, 0, 0);"><br>
</div>
<div style="color: rgb(0, 0, 0);">Thanks,</div>
<div style="color: rgb(0, 0, 0);">Jeff</div>
<div style="color: rgb(0, 0, 0);"><br>
</div>
<span id="OLK_SRC_BODY_SECTION" style="color: rgb(0, 0, 0);">
<blockquote id="MAC_OUTLOOK_ATTRIBUTION_BLOCKQUOTE" style="BORDER-LEFT: #b5c4df 5 solid; PADDING:0 0 0 5; MARGIN:0 0 0 5;">
<div>
<div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">
<div><br class="">
</div>
<div>
<blockquote type="cite" class="">
<div class="">
<div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">
<div class="">
<div style="font-family: Calibri, sans-serif; font-size: 14px;" class="">
<div id="" class=""></div>
</div>
</div>
<div style="font-family: Calibri, sans-serif; font-size: 14px;" class=""></div>
</div>
</div>
</blockquote>
<div class="">
<div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">
<div style="font-family: Calibri, sans-serif; font-size: 14px;" class=""><br class="">
</div>
</div>
</div>
<blockquote type="cite" class="">
<div class="">
<div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">
<div style="font-family: Calibri, sans-serif; font-size: 14px;" class=""></div>
<span id="OLK_SRC_BODY_SECTION" style="font-family: Calibri, sans-serif; font-size: 14px;" class="">
<div style="font-family: Calibri; font-size: 12pt; text-align: left; border-width: 1pt medium medium; border-style: solid none none; padding: 3pt 0in 0in; border-top-color: rgb(181, 196, 223);" class="">
<span style="font-weight:bold" class="">From: </span>Lixia Zhang <<a href="mailto:lixia@cs.ucla.edu" class="">lixia@cs.ucla.edu</a>><br class="">
<span style="font-weight:bold" class="">Date: </span>Tuesday, February 23, 2016 at 3:46 PM<br class="">
<span style="font-weight:bold" class="">To: </span>Jeff Burke <<a href="mailto:jburke@remap.ucla.edu" class="">jburke@remap.ucla.edu</a>><br class="">
<span style="font-weight:bold" class="">Cc: </span>"<a href="mailto:nfd-dev@lists.cs.ucla.edu" class="">nfd-dev@lists.cs.ucla.edu</a>" <<a href="mailto:nfd-dev@lists.cs.ucla.edu" class="">nfd-dev@lists.cs.ucla.edu</a>><br class="">
<span style="font-weight:bold" class="">Subject: </span>Re: [Nfd-dev] What is a "region" ?<br class="">
</div>
<div class=""><br class="">
</div>
<blockquote id="MAC_OUTLOOK_ATTRIBUTION_BLOCKQUOTE" style="BORDER-LEFT: #b5c4df 5 solid; PADDING:0 0 0 5; MARGIN:0 0 0 5;" class="" type="cite">
<div class="">
<div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;" class="">
we are in group meeting now and explained how LINK (= forwarding hint) works to Zhehao and Haitao. We also trying to figure out a solution to the function you wanted (NDNfit's original design was based on a misconception of LINK).
<div class=""><br class="">
</div>
<div class="">LINK is a forwarding hint, it just carries an interest to the place where the name in the interest can be used directly for lookup.</div>
<div class="">
<div class=""><br class="">
</div>
<div class="">Lixia</div>
<div class=""><br class="">
<div class="">
<blockquote type="cite" class="">
<div class="">On Feb 23, 2016, at 1:24 PM, Burke, Jeff <<a href="mailto:jburke@remap.ucla.edu" class="">jburke@remap.ucla.edu</a>> wrote:</div>
<div class="">
<div style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; font-size: 14px; font-family: Calibri, sans-serif;" class="">
<div class=""><br class="">
</div>
<div class="">Hi,</div>
<div class=""><br class="">
</div>
<div class="">Even after looking at relevant sections in the NFD developer's guide, we are blocked on finishing the NDNFit forwarding hint design by not understanding the specific definition of what  a "region" is, and how they should be confirmed in practice... </div>
<div class=""><br class="">
</div>
<div class="">For example, see section 4.2 of the NFD developer's guide.</div>
<div class=""><a href="http://named-data.net/wp-content/uploads/2015/10/ndn-0021-5-nfd-developer-guide.pdf" class="">http://named-data.net/wp-content/uploads/2015/10/ndn-0021-5-nfd-developer-guide.pdf</a></div>
<div class=""><span id="cid:597A9946-58BB-4C0C-A3FA-3825AEE7390A" class=""><Screenshot 2016-02-23 13.18.21.png></span></div>
<div class=""><br class="">
</div>
<div class=""><br class="">
</div>
<div class="">
<div class="">1) What is a region? </div>
<div class="">2) How should they be configured at each NFD? </div>
<div class="">3) [And, who is expected to configure them, and when?] </div>
</div>
<div class=""><br class="">
</div>
<div class="">Thanks,</div>
<div class="">Jeff</div>
<div class=""><br class="">
</div>
<div class="">
<div id="" class=""></div>
</div>
</div>
_______________________________________________<br class="">
Nfd-dev mailing list<br class="">
<a href="mailto:Nfd-dev@lists.cs.ucla.edu" class="">Nfd-dev@lists.cs.ucla.edu</a><br class="">
<a href="http://www.lists.cs.ucla.edu/mailman/listinfo/nfd-dev" class="">http://www.lists.cs.ucla.edu/mailman/listinfo/nfd-dev</a><br class="">
</div>
</blockquote>
</div>
<br class="">
</div>
</div>
</div>
</div>
</blockquote>
</span></div>
</div>
</blockquote>
</div>
<br class="">
</div>
</div>
</blockquote>
</span>
</body>
</html>